How they compare

Belarus currently reports 0.7043 against 0.6971 in Portugal, a difference of 0.0072.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 18 shared years of data; in 2003 it was Portugal ahead.

Belarus ranks 43rd and Portugal ranks 44th of 60 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Belarus averaged higher in 2 and Portugal in 1.

The Fiscal Decentralization dataset includes fiscal decentralization indicators for a sample of IMF member countries. The following indicators are included in the dataset: Revenue and Expenditure Decentralization Shares; Transfer dependency and Vertical Fiscal Imbalances; Deficit and Debt; Allocation of expenditure (economic classification); Allocation of expenditure (functional classification); Allocation of non-Tax Revenues; and Allocation of Taxes.
